Tokenizing the Tangible: Explaining Real-World Assets in Crypto

Blockchain technology has opened up new possibilities in the world of finance, particularly with the introduction of real-world assets (RWAs) into the cryptocurrency ecosystem. This article explores the concept of RWAs, their tokenization, and their impact on the crypto market.

What is RWA?

Real-World Assets (RWAs) refer to any product or financial vehicle that derives value outside the blockchain ecosystem. These can include tangible items like commodities, real estate, and fine art, as well as intangible assets such as legal documents, intellectual property, and personal ID information. RWAs also encompass traditional financial products like equities, bonds, and precious metals. The key characteristic of RWAs is that they hold value in the non-blockchain world.

What is tokenizing real-world assets?

Tokenization in the context of cryptocurrency involves creating a digital representation of an RWA on a blockchain. These tokenized RWAs have the same monetary value as their real-world counterparts but exist as crypto assets on a blockchain. They are considered 'synthetic' assets, as they reflect the value of an underlying asset rather than being the literal asset itself. Tokenized RWAs can represent full ownership rights or be divided into smaller units, each representing a partial share of the underlying asset's value.

How are RWAs used in cryptocurrency?

RWA tokens have various applications in the decentralized finance (DeFi) sector:

  1. Asset-backed virtual tokens: Stablecoins and commodity-pegged tokens provide traders with ways to enter and exit crypto markets without constantly moving funds off-chain.

  2. P2P lending and borrowing: RWA tokens can be used as collateral for DeFi loans or offered as fractionalized shares to earn interest.

  3. Crowdfunding ventures: Token fractionalization allows entrepreneurs to attract funds from a global audience of crypto traders.

  4. Ownership rights: Blockchain's immutable nature makes it ideal for verifying RWA ownership, reducing risks of fraud and human error.

  5. Supply chain management: Companies can tokenize various aspects of their supply chain for improved transparency and record-keeping.

  6. Decentralized identity: Technologies like soulbound tokens (SLTs) are paving the way for secure, privacy-preserving digital identities.

What are real world assets in crypto?

Real world assets in crypto are tokenized versions of physical assets like real estate, commodities, or art, allowing them to be traded on blockchain platforms for increased liquidity and accessibility.

Which crypto coins are RWA?

Popular RWA crypto coins include USDT, USDC, PAXG, and WBTC. These tokens are backed by real-world assets like fiat currencies, gold, or Bitcoin, providing stability and tangible value in the crypto market.

What cryptos are tokenizing real world assets?

Several cryptos are tokenizing real assets, including RealT (real estate), Paxos Gold (gold), and Centrifuge (invoices and loans). Chainlink and Maker are also exploring RWA tokenization.
